September’s full moon is called the “corn moon”, because it occurs around the time that corn is ready for harvesting before fall frost sets in.

Learn to navigate by compass in the waning daylight hours as we approach the autumn equinox, then practice your navigation skills on a guided moonlit hike.

Chestnut Hill by Moonlight invites you to experience a magical full moon evening on the farm.

Celebrate community with your fellow evening hikers.

Marvel as day turns into night as the sun sets and the moon rises, then go on a guided hike by moonlight.

Make wishes as stars pop out one by one, and look for familiar constellations.

Campfires may be a part of the event, depending on weather and current drought conditions.

Your guide will be ranger Bob, a local scoutmaster and devoted member of the Trustees community.

This family friendly event welcomes adults and children.

Please note: though we love dogs, they are not permitted at Chestnut Hill Farm.
